🌤️ Weather in Bariloche at Christmas
December marks the beginning of the Patagonian summer. Daytime temperatures usually range between 8°C (46°F) in the morning and 22°C (72°F) in the afternoon, with long daylight hours and plenty of sunshine. It’s perfect for hiking, sightseeing and enjoying Lake Nahuel Huapi.
Tip: weather can change quickly in Patagonia, so bringing a light jacket is always recommended.
🚶♂️ Things to do in Bariloche at Christmas
There are plenty of activities to enjoy during the holiday season:
-
Hiking and scenic viewpoints such as Cerro Campanario, Circuito Chico and Cerro Otto.
-
Kayaking, boat tours and relaxing picnics along the shores of Lake Nahuel Huapi.
-
Exploring the historic Civic Center, artisan markets and seasonal cultural events.
-
Day trips to Villa La Angostura or driving the famous Seven Lakes Route, one of the most beautiful scenic roads in Patagonia.

🏨 Accommodation tips for Christmas
Christmas marks the start of the high travel season in Bariloche. Hotels, cabins and vacation rentals — particularly those with lake views — tend to book up quickly. Reserving accommodation ahead of time helps ensure better availability and location options.
⚠️ Important to know
Fireworks are strictly prohibited in Bariloche, and during summer the risk of wildfires is extremely high. Visitors are asked to follow local regulations and take extra care with fire to help protect Patagonia’s unique natural environment.
